Scotland has experienced extraordinary growth and change during the course of its lifetime - it’s a place that has been invaded and settled many times and that has made mighty … how do sharks and pilot fish helpWebKenneth I MacAlpin, King of Dalriada and then Pictavia. In his time Dalriada fell to the Norse Vikings and Iona Abbey was abandoned. He raided south of the Forth, and his lands were raided by both Strathclyde Britons (Dunblane) and Danes (Dunkeld). Immortalised by Maggie Smith in a 1969 film of the same name, The Prime of Miss Jean Brodie tells the story of an eccentric ... how do shark teeth growWeb24 nov. 2024 · Macbeth Macfinlay (aka Mac Bethad mac Findláig) reigned as the king of Scotland from 1040 to 1057 CE. The ruler of Moray, he took the throne via the battlefield from his predecessor Duncan I of Scotland (r. 1034-1040 CE).
